محمد حجازي قام بنشر يونيو 24, 2005 قام بنشر يونيو 24, 2005 السلام عليكم ... وقوفاً عند رغبة الأعضاء سنقوم بافتتاح مشروع لكتاب يشرح الدوال في الاكسل . و لكن من المؤلفون ؟!!!!!!!!!! المؤلفون هم أنتم :( ، و الباب مفتوح لكل عضو ليقدم ما لديه من علم ، و تيقنوا أن كل معلومة _مهما كانت صغيرة_ ستجازون عليها خير الجزاء من قبل الله أكرم الأكرمين . الكتاب سيتضمن إن شاء الله شرح لجميع الدوال الموجودة في الاكسل دون إغفال أي منها ، و بالتالي فلا تستصغروا شرح الدوال البسيطة أو الشائعة الاستخدام. و سيكون هناك (في كل فترة) إصدار متجدد لهذا الكتاب على صورة ملف PDF متضمناً آخر الشروح بالإضافة للشروح السابقة ، وجميعها ممهور بأسماء من أعدها. (y) و سيتم إن شاء الله تعيين مشرفين على هذا المشروع من أعضاء هذا المنتدى ، مهمتهم متابعة المشروع و إخراج النسخة النهائية من كل إصدار . شروط طرح المشاركات : 1. لا يجوز نقل الشروح من أي مرجع بصورة حرفية ، و يجب ذكر المراجع التي اعتمد عليها العضو في الشرح (إن وجدت) . 2. لا ضير من إدراج شرح لدالة قد تم التطرق إليها من قبل. 3. من الممكن دمج الشرح ليتناول أكثر من دالة بشروط وجود ترابط حقيقي بين الدوال المشروحة (كأن يقوم العضو بشرح الدوال VLOOKUP و LOOKUP و HLOOKUP موضحاً الفرق بينها). 4. لا يجوز للشخص إدراج شرح كان قد أدرجه سابقاً في أحد المنتديات أو الدروس أو الدوريات قبل حصوله على موافقة مسبقة من الجهة التي نشرت شرحه مسبقاً . 5. هيكل الشرح (مطروح للمناقشة إلى أن يتم الاعتماد على هيكل محدد). أما بقية الشروط فمتروكة للأعضاء . :pp: تحياتي
علي السحيب قام بنشر يونيو 24, 2005 قام بنشر يونيو 24, 2005 (معدل) السلام عليكم، هذه فكرة رائعة يا أستاذ محمد حجازي .. وأتشرف بأن أضع أول حجر في هذا المشروع وهو شرح كامل وتام قمت بإعداده عن الدالة DATEDIF .. والتي تستخدم في حساب الفرق بين تاريخين. وسوف أقوم من وقت لأخر بوضع شرح وافي لدالة جديدة من دوال الإكسل، شكراً للجميع،\ DATEDIF_Explenation.rar DATEDIF_Example.rar تم تعديل نوفمبر 15, 2005 بواسطه علي السحيب
ramez قام بنشر يونيو 24, 2005 قام بنشر يونيو 24, 2005 ملف اكسيل بسيط لدوال بسيطة .. _________________.zip
محمد حجازي قام بنشر يونيو 24, 2005 الكاتب قام بنشر يونيو 24, 2005 السلام عليكم ... هذا شرح لدوال قواعد البيانات كنت قد أدرجته سابقاً في المنتدى : http://www.officena.net/ib/index.php?showtopic=8015
محمد حجازي قام بنشر يونيو 24, 2005 الكاتب قام بنشر يونيو 24, 2005 السلام عليكم ... وهذا أيضاً ملف يتضمن درساً كنت قد بدأت بكتابته في الماضي و حالت الظروف دون إكمالي له . سأقوم بوضعه هنا ليتم الاستفادة من بعض أجزاءه : Function.rar
الرواحي قام بنشر يونيو 26, 2005 قام بنشر يونيو 26, 2005 هذا تعديل للوصلة السابقة حيث يوجد بها خطأ ولم أستطع تحرير مشاركتي وإليكم الوصلة الجديدة من هنا من فضلك عذرا على الخطأ وشكرا الرواحي
علي السحيب قام بنشر يونيو 26, 2005 قام بنشر يونيو 26, 2005 (معدل) السلام عليكم، أخي الروحاني .. ما قمت بطرحة فكرة ممتازة ولكن يوجد لدي ملاحظتين أرجوا أن يتسع صدرك لهما: الأولى هي أن صيغة التنسيق الشرطي المستخدمة تعمل مع تواريخ هذه السنة فقط .. أما إذا ما قمنا بتغيير التاريخ إلى أحد تواريخ السنة القادمة .. فإنها لن تعمل. الملاحظة الثانية هي أني أرى أنه من المتعب وضع تنسيق شرطي لثلاثين خلية كلُ على حدى. لذا قمت بتعديل بسيط على الصيغة وعلى التنسيق الشرطي. وقمت كذلك بوضع صيغة موحدة للتنسيق الشرطي بدلآ من ثلاثين صيغة وأيضاً لكي تتماشى مع جميع التواريخ القادمة وليس تواريخ هذه السنة فقط. وإليكم المرفق، تحياتي s_Date.rar تم تعديل نوفمبر 15, 2005 بواسطه علي السحيب
baran قام بنشر يونيو 26, 2005 قام بنشر يونيو 26, 2005 (معدل) لدي شرح لجميع الدالات وبشكل رائع سأدرجها في القسم المؤقت وهي في ملف وورد استفيدو منها بأي شكل أردتم اسم الملف الذي سأدرجه باسم Baran_FX وهو عبارة عن ثمانية صفحات كتبت فيها الأكثر استعمالاً وكما ذكر الأخ رضوان سبحان ملك الملوك , و سلطان السلاطين , رب السماوات و الأرض , ورب العرش العظيم تم تعديل يونيو 26, 2005 بواسطه baran
الرواحي قام بنشر يونيو 27, 2005 قام بنشر يونيو 27, 2005 وعليكم السلام أخي لاف كاندل, في الحقيقة أنا سعيد جدا بتواجدي معكم أستاذي الفاضل و أهم ما في الأمر أن نستفيد جميعا من هذه الدروس . شكرا جزيلا لك أخي باران مرحبا بك و بدروسك ... ونحن بإنتظارها تحياتي ... الرواحي
ramez قام بنشر يونيو 27, 2005 قام بنشر يونيو 27, 2005 بالنسبة لي مازلت اتابع مساهمات الأخوة في هذا المجال .. وان كنت ارى انه مازال قصورا في تنشيط المشاركات ، ربما لأنني استعجل الافادة ! - اتمنى من جميع الأخوة ان يرفقوا الدالة مرفقا بمثال تطبيقي ، فمثلا مازلت بانتظار ارفاق الأخ LoveCandle بمثال عن الدالة التي طرحها حيث فشلت في تطبيقها حتى الآن ! - أما بالنسبة للأخ baran ، فللمرة الثانية التي يعدنا بها بملف جاهز عن شروحات الدوال ، وحتى الآن لم نجده ! -الشكر لجميع الأخوة ومنهم أيضا الأخ محمد حجازي .. - مع ملاحظة ألتمس من الجميع ان يهتموا بها وهي الاهتمام اكثر بالشروحات بارفاقهم الأمثلة في تطبيقها ،خاصة بالنسبة للمبتدئين أمثالي في عالم الدوال الواسع .. أشكركم جميعا ..!
علي السحيب قام بنشر يونيو 30, 2005 قام بنشر يونيو 30, 2005 (معدل) السلام عليكم، أعتقد أن الملف المرفق يفي بالغرض، لأن به شروحات على جميع استخدامات الدالة DATEDIF .. لكن إذا كنت ترغب بالمزيد فراجع الرابط التالي: http://www.officena.net/ib/index.php?showtopic=7916 فإن به ملف يحتوي على شرح لجميع استخدامات الدالة. ولكي تتعرف أكثر على الفائدة الكبرى من هذه الدالة قم بمشاهدة المرفق المسمى Age Calculation .. والموجود ضمن مشاركاتي في الموضوع الموجود على الرابط السابق .. وللإطلاع عليه استخدم كلمة المرور ali شكراً للجميع، تم تعديل نوفمبر 30, 2006 بواسطه علي السحيب
ramez قام بنشر يوليو 2, 2005 قام بنشر يوليو 2, 2005 كل الشكر اليك أخي LoveCandle .. بانتظار المزيد .. الاترى ان همّة الأخوة قد فَتَرت لاستكمال شرح الدوال ! على الأقل الدوال المتوفرة والجاهزة في قائمة الاكسل !!
محمد حجازي قام بنشر يوليو 3, 2005 الكاتب قام بنشر يوليو 3, 2005 الدوال المنطقية : تمهيداً لفهم طبيعة هذه الدوال نورد المثال التالي : من المفترض أنك تعودت على كتابة صيغ حسابية عادية تحتوي عمليات الجميع و الضرب و ... الخ ، ولكن ماذا عن الصيغ المنطقية ؟ . الآن قم بكتابة الصيغة المنطقية التالية في شريط الصيغة و لكن بدون أن تدرجها : =A1>0 ماذا تتوقع أن تعطي الصيغة السابقة ؟ . حسناً ستقول أن الاكسل لن يفهم المقصود من هذه الصيغة أو لن يستطيع التعبير عنها على أقل تقدير !. و سيقوم حتماُ بإرجاع خطأ معين عندما يقوم بقراءتها. و لكن يا أخ قد يكون تخمينك في غير محله :p أدرج الصيغة السابقة و لاحظ النتيجة الاكسل يقوم بإرجاع إحدى القيمتين TRUE أو FALSE وذلك ليخبرنا عما إذا كانت الصيغة المنطقية السابقة محققة أم لا . الآن بعد التمهيد السابق لنبدأ بالتعرف على الدوال المنطقية التي يوفرها لنا الاكسل : الدالة AND : الدالة AND هي دالة منطقية تتعامل مع قيم منطقية (شأنها شأن الـ OR و الـ NOT) . ما المقصود بذلك ؟ ببساطة يجب أن تكون مدخلات هذه الدالة عبارة عن قيم منطقية (ناتجة عن علاقات منطقية محددة) لتقوم بدورها بإرجاع قيمة منطقية أيضاً . أي أنه يجب أن تكون جميع وسائط هذه الدالة عبارة عن علاقات منطقية . الدالة AND تقوم بإرجاع القيمة TRUE إذا كانت جميع مدخلاتها هي TRUE ، و تقوم بإرجاع القيمة FALSE إذا كان هناك مدخل واحد أو أكثر من مدخلاتها FALSE ، لاحظ الصيغة التالية : =AND(A1>0;B1=5) لاحظ أن الدالة السابقة ترجع القيمة TRUE في حالة واحدة فقط وهي أن تكون القيمة الموجودة في الخلية A1 أكبر من الصفر و القيمة الموجودة في الخلية B1 تساوي 5 ، و إلا فسوف ترجع القيمة FALSE . يمكنك زيادة عدد الشروط كما تشاء (ضمن حدود الاكسل) وذلك عن طريق فصل هذه الشروط (العلاقات المنطقية) عن بعضها بالفاصلة المنقوطة (شأنها شأن الـ OR) . الدالة OR : الدالة OR تقوم بإرجاع القيمة TRUE إذا كان هناك مدخل واحد على الأقل من مدخلاتها TRUE ، و تقوم بإرجاع القيمة FALSE إذا كانت جميع مدخلاتها FALSE ، لاحظ الصيغة التالية : =OR(A1<0;B1=10) لاحظ أن الدالة السابقة ترجع القيمة TRUE إذا كانت القيمة الموجودة في الخلية A1 أصغر من الصفر ، أو إذا كانت القيمة الموجودة في الخلية B1 تساوي 10 ، أو إذا تحققت العلاقتين السابقتين معاً ، و ترجع القيمة FALSE في حالة كون القيمة الموجودة في الخلية A1 ليست أصغر من الصفر و القيمة الموجودة في الخلية B1 لا تساوي 10 . الدالة NOT : تقوم هذه الدالة بعكس القيمة المنطقية لمدخلها ، فإذا كانت قيمة مدخلها TRUE فإنها ترجع FALSE ، و إذا كانت قيمة مدخلها FALSE فإنها ترجع TRUE ، لاحظ الصيغة التالية : =NOT(A1=0) الدالة السابقة ترجع القيمة TRUE في حال كون القيمة الموجودة في الخلية A1 لا تساوي الصفر ، و ترجع القيمة FALSE في حال كون القيمة الموجودة في الخلية A1 تساوي الصفر . يمكن الاستعاضة عن الصيغة السابقة بالصيغة : =A1<>0 الدالة NOT لا تتعامل سوى مع وسيط واحد . يمكننا أن نقوم بدمج الدوال السابقة (AND و OR و NOT) عن طريق تداخل الدوال ، لاحظ الصيغة التالية : =NOT(OR(AND(A1>0;B1=5);AND(A1<0;B1=10))) الآن بعد أن تعرفنا على الدوال السابقة قد تتساءل في أي شييء يمكننا استخدامهم ؟!! قد تجد جواباً لسؤالك بعد أن تتعرف على الدالة IF :pp: الدالة IF : الشكل العام لهذه الدالة هو كما يلي : =IF(condition;result1;result2) في المدخل الأول condition يجب وضع الشرط أو الدالة المنطقية أو العلاقة المنطقية التي ستعطي إحدى القيمتين TRUE و FALSE. إذا كانت قيمة المدخل الأول TRUE فإن الدالة IF ستنفذ الصيغة الموجودة (أو ترجع القيمة الموجودة) في جواب الشرط الأول result1 . و إذا كانت قيمة المدخل الأول FALSE فإن الدالة IF ستنفذ الصيغة الموجودة (أو ترجع القيمة الموجودة) في جواب الشرط الثاني result2 . لاحظ الصيغ التالية : =IF(A1>=50;"ناجح";"راسب") =IF(A1>B1;A1-B1;B1-A1) =IF(NOT(OR(A1="";B1=""));A1+B1;) =IF(COUNT(A1:A5)=5;SUM(A1:A5);"") =IF(ISNA(VLOOKUP(C2;A2:B10;2;FALSE));"";VLOOKUP(C2;A2:B10;2;FALSE)) ويمكننا استثمار الدالة IF في تداخل الدوال ، لاحظ الصيغة التالية : =IF(A1<0;"";IF(A1<50;"راسب";IF(A1<60;"مقبول";IF(A1<70;"جيد";IF(A1<80;"جيد جداً";IF(A1<90;"ممتاز";IF(A1<=100;"درجة الشرف";""))))))) أرجو أن أكون قد وفقت في إيصال المعلومة .... تحياتي 1
علي السحيب قام بنشر يوليو 4, 2005 قام بنشر يوليو 4, 2005 السلام عليكم، الوصلة التالية تحتوي على شرح شامل عن الدالة TEXT http://www.officena.net/ib/index.php?showtopic=8726 أتمنى أن يستفيد منها الجميع،
محمد حجازي قام بنشر يوليو 4, 2005 الكاتب قام بنشر يوليو 4, 2005 السلام عليكم ... شكراً للأخ LoveCandle على هذا الشرح المميز . بالنسبة للكتاب المقترح تجميعه ، أرى أن يكون على صيغة xls بدلاً من pdf وذلك لأن أغلب الأعضاء تستهويهم على ما يبدو فكرة شرح الدوال بواسطة ملف اكسل. ما رأيكم؟
علي السحيب قام بنشر يوليو 5, 2005 قام بنشر يوليو 5, 2005 (معدل) السلام عليكم، أنت على حق أخي محمد .. وضع أمثلة للدوال داخل ملف إكسل أفضل من أي طريقة آخرى .. لأن مثال واحد يعبر عن ألف سطر من الكتابة. تم تعديل يوليو 5, 2005 بواسطه LoveCandle
صهيب جاويش قام بنشر أغسطس 9, 2005 قام بنشر أغسطس 9, 2005 لقد ابتدات بشرح مختصر لكل الدوال الواردة في البرنامج و لكنني سوف اضعها في منتدى المحيط العربي على هذا الرابط http://www.arabmoheet.net/forum/default.as...e=2&forum_no=65 و البداية سوف تكون مع الدوال الاحصائية البالغ عددها 79 دالة و معها ملف مرفق لامثلة كل دالة في ورفة
ابوعمر5 قام بنشر سبتمبر 29, 2005 قام بنشر سبتمبر 29, 2005 الله يعطيكم العافية وجعل الله ذلك في موازين اعمالكم جميعا وخصوصا استاذنا محمد حجازي
منصور العتيبي قام بنشر يونيو 8, 2006 قام بنشر يونيو 8, 2006 شكرا لكم اعضاء هذا المنتدى انا عضو جديد ومبتدئ جدا في الاكسل اتمنى ان تقبلوني معكم سؤالي هو اذا كانت البيانات تتحدث في نفس الخليه من موقع اخر كيف اجمعها
islam11 قام بنشر يوليو 1, 2006 قام بنشر يوليو 1, 2006 السلام عليكم، أعتقد أن الملف المرفق يفي بالغرض، لأن به شروحات على جميع استخدامات الدالة DATEDIF .. لكن إذا كنت ترغب بالمزيد فراجع الرابط التالي: http://www.officena.net/ib/index.php?showt...7916 فإن به ملف يحتوي على شرح لجميع استخدامات الدالة. ولكي تتعرف أكثر على الفائدة الكبرى من هذه الدالة قم بمشاهدة المرفق المسمى Age Calculation .. والموجود ضمن مشاركاتي في الموضوع الموجود على الرابط السابق .. وللإطلاع عليه استخدم كلمة المرور ali شكراً للجميع، ــــــــــــــــــــــــــــــــــــــــــــــــــــــــــــــــــــــــــــــــ ــــــــــــــــــــــــــــ الأستاذ العظيم / علي السحيب السلام عليكم ورحمته و بركاته يحثت عن الملف الذي يحتوي على شرح لجميع استخدامات دالة DATEDIF في الرابط المذكور فلم أجده .. فعرفني كيف أصل اليه ؟ ولك شكري وتقديري .
inas aly قام بنشر يوليو 18, 2006 قام بنشر يوليو 18, 2006 الأساتذة العظام ... حياكم الله رجاء أكملوا مابدأتموه لكي يعتبر مرجعا حصريا لشرح دوال الاكسيل
الردود الموصى بها
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.